Understanding Woven PP Sacks

Woven polypropylene (PP) sacks are made from woven plastic fibers. They are known for their robust nature and versatility. These sacks are lightweight yet exceptionally strong, making them ideal for various applications. From agricultural products to construction materials, woven PP sacks are widely used.

Advantages of Woven PP Sacks

Durability and Strength

One of the standout features of woven PP sacks is their strength. Unlike traditional paper or plastic bags, these sacks can carry heavy loads without tearing. This durability brings many benefits to businesses. For example, companies can pack their products with confidence, knowing that the packaging won’t fail.

Cost-Effectiveness

Another advantage of woven PP sacks is their cost-effectiveness. While the initial investment may be slightly higher than traditional bags, they last much longer. This longevity means that businesses save money over time. Replacing torn or damaged bags can lead to significant costs. Woven PP sacks minimize these expenses.

Eco-Friendly Options

In today’s eco-conscious world, the environmental impact of packaging materials is crucial. Woven PP sacks can be made from recycled materials, making them a more sustainable option. They are also reusable, which helps reduce waste. Businesses looking to improve their green credentials can benefit from switching to woven PP sacks.

Versatile Applications

Woven PP sacks are incredibly versatile. They come in various sizes, shapes, and colors. This versatility allows businesses to customize their packaging according to their needs. Whether for agricultural use, food packaging, or industrial applications, woven PP sacks provide options that traditional bags cannot.

Disadvantages of Traditional Bags

Limited Strength

Traditional bags, such as paper or basic plastic, often lack the strength of woven PP sacks. They can tear easily, especially when carrying heavy items. This weakness can lead to product loss and dissatisfied customers.

Higher Long-Term Costs

While traditional bags may have a lower initial cost, they often require frequent replacements. The need to replace torn bags can quickly add up in expenses. Consequently, businesses might end up spending more on traditional bags in the long run.

Environmental Concerns

Many traditional bags, especially those made from non-biodegradable plastics, pose serious environmental risks. They can take hundreds of years to decompose. Using woven PP sacks instead can help businesses reduce their ecological footprint.
